+#ifndef _AIE2_SOLVER_H
+#define _AIE2_SOLVER_H
+
+#define XRS_MAX_COL 128
+
+/*
+ * Structure used to describe a partition. A partition is column based
+ * allocation unit described by its start column and number of columns.
+ */
+struct aie_part {
+ u32 start_col;
+ u32 ncols;
+};
+
+/*
+ * The QoS capabilities of a given AIE partition.
+ */
+struct aie_qos_cap {
+ u32 opc; /* operations per cycle */
+ u32 dma_bw; /* DMA bandwidth */
+};
+
+/*
+ * QoS requirement of a resource allocation.
+ */
+struct aie_qos {
+ u32 gops; /* Giga operations */
+ u32 fps; /* Frames per second */
+ u32 dma_bw; /* DMA bandwidth */
+ u32 latency; /* Frame response latency */
+ u32 exec_time; /* Frame execution time */
+ u32 priority; /* Request priority */
+};
+
+/*
+ * Structure used to describe a relocatable CDO (Configuration Data Object).
+ */
+struct cdo_parts {
+ u32 *start_cols; /* Start column array */
+ u32 cols_len; /* Length of start column array */
+ u32 ncols; /* # of column */
+ struct aie_qos_cap qos_cap; /* CDO QoS capabilities */
+};
+
+/*
+ * Structure used to describe a request to allocate.
+ */
+struct alloc_requests {
+ u64 rid;
+ struct cdo_parts cdo;
+ struct aie_qos rqos; /* Requested QoS */
+};
+
+/*
+ * Load callback argument
+ */
+struct xrs_action_load {
+ u32 rid;
+ struct aie_part part;
+};
+
+/*
+ * Define the power level available
+ *
+ * POWER_LEVEL_MIN:
+ * Lowest power level. Usually set when all actions are unloaded.
+ *
+ * POWER_LEVEL_n
+ * Power levels 0 - n, is a step increase in system frequencies
+ */
+enum power_level {
+ POWER_LEVEL_MIN = 0x0,
+ POWER_LEVEL_0 = 0x1,
+ POWER_LEVEL_1 = 0x2,
+ POWER_LEVEL_2 = 0x3,
+ POWER_LEVEL_3 = 0x4,
+ POWER_LEVEL_4 = 0x5,
+ POWER_LEVEL_5 = 0x6,
+ POWER_LEVEL_6 = 0x7,
+ POWER_LEVEL_7 = 0x8,
+ POWER_LEVEL_NUM,
+};
+
+/*
+ * Structure used to describe the frequency table.
+ * Resource solver chooses the frequency from the table
+ * to meet the QOS requirements.
+ */
+struct clk_list_info {
+ u32 num_levels; /* available power levels */
+ u32 cu_clk_list[POWER_LEVEL_NUM]; /* available aie clock frequencies in Mhz*/
+};
+
+struct xrs_action_ops {
+ int (*load)(void *cb_arg, struct xrs_action_load *action);
+ int (*unload)(void *cb_arg);
+ int (*set_dft_dpm_level)(struct drm_device *ddev, u32 level);
+};
+
+/*
+ * Structure used to describe information for solver during initialization.
+ */
+struct init_config {
+ u32 total_col;
+ u32 sys_eff_factor; /* system efficiency factor */
+ u32 latency_adj; /* latency adjustment in ms */
+ struct clk_list_info clk_list; /* List of frequencies available in system */
+ struct drm_device *ddev;
+ struct xrs_action_ops *actions;
+};
+
+/*
+ * xrsm_init() - Register resource solver. Resource solver client needs
+ * to call this function to register itself.
+ *
+ * @cfg: The system metrics for resource solver to use
+ *
+ * Return: A resource solver handle
+ *
+ * Note: We should only create one handle per AIE array to be managed.
+ */
+void *xrsm_init(struct init_config *cfg);
+
+/*
+ * xrs_allocate_resource() - Request to allocate resources for a given context
+ * and a partition metadata. (See struct part_meta)
+ *
+ * @hdl: Resource solver handle obtained from xrs_init()
+ * @req: Input to the Resource solver including request id
+ * and partition metadata.
+ * @cb_arg: callback argument pointer
+ *
+ * Return: 0 when successful.
+ * Or standard error number when failing
+ *
+ * Note:
+ * There is no lock mechanism inside resource solver. So it is
+ * the caller's responsibility to lock down XCLBINs and grab
+ * necessary lock.
+ */
+int xrs_allocate_resource(void *hdl, struct alloc_requests *req, void *cb_arg);
+
+/*
+ * xrs_release_resource() - Request to free resources for a given context.
+ *
+ * @hdl: Resource solver handle obtained from xrs_init()
+ * @rid: The Request ID to identify the requesting context
+ */
+int xrs_release_resource(void *hdl, u64 rid);
+#endif /* _AIE2_SOLVER_H */
